Trader consensus favors Stade Rennais FC at 45.5% implied probability in this Ligue 1 Brittany derby at Stade Francis-Le Blé, driven by their higher table position (7th with 43 points from 26 matches) and dominant head-to-head record (17 wins to Brest's 6 across 31 meetings), including a 3-1 victory over Brest earlier this season in GW16. Brest, sitting 11th on 36 points, benefits from home advantage and a clean bill of health with no reported unavailable players, boosting their 26.5% chance amid a closely contested market. Rennes faces challenges from suspensions to right-back Przemyslaw Frankowski and center-back Anthony Rouault, plus potential injury concerns, contributing to the draw's solid 25.5% pricing in what remains a competitive matchup shaped by recent form and defensive absences.

If Stade Brestois 29 wins, this market will resolve to "Yes".
Otherwise, this market will resolve to "No".
If the game is postponed, this market will remain open until the game has been completed.
If the game is canceled entirely, with no make-up game, this market will resolve "No".
This market refers only to the outcome within the first 90 minutes of regular play plus stoppage time.
The primary resolution source for this market is the official statistics of the event as recognized by the governing body or event organizers. However, if the governing body or event organizers have not published final match statistics within 2 hours after the event's conclusion, a consensus of credible reporting may be used instead.
